Hey all!
I have been meaning to do this project for years now. I finally decided to just do it. I wish I would have taken more pictures/detailed video, but with two kids, my free time is slim. So I did what I could.
I couldnt find much in the way of write ups or pictures when it came to installing a power antenna. Most guys will find a factory unit and install it. However, they're EXPENSIVE if you get a new one, and sometimes arent very good quality. I had a couple generic antenna laying around and decided to make it work.
There are threads where people have used them, and I think one even mentioned using PVC pipe, but Ive never seen pictures.
Here's a video showing how I did it, and the results. Hopefully it helps someone out!

Re: How To - Installing Universal Power Antenna w/Video
Quick question, what did you use to cut the housing and how did you cut it? Also what was the total length when done?
Thread Starter
Joined: Sep 2002
Posts: 3,685
Likes: 10
From: PA
Car: 86 Trans AM
Engine: LS1 (not stock...)
Transmission: Built T56
Axle/Gears: Strange 12-bolt w/ 3.73
Re: How To - Installing Universal Power Antenna w/Video
The mast housing is just aluminum tube. Very thin wall. I just cut it with a hack saw. I made sure i drew a line all the way around and made the cut straight.
As for the total length, I guessed at it when i was building it. I believe it was around 4.5" extra length. I can try to confirm that for you...let me check and if I can verify I will let ya know.
